    BF 2142 problem

    I have BF 2142 working fine on my main PC, which is connected directly to the internet. Another PC I have is connected to the internet via, microsoft's "internet connection Sharing ." Within a few seconds of joining a server I get the error message "connection to the server has been lost." It must be something to do with the fact im not connected directly to the internet. Does anybody have any idea's how I could get BF 2142 working?
